Supergreen hydrogen creation could capture carbon from the air and de-acidify the oceans

2013-05-28 16:02:57| Extremetech

A team from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ory claims to have found a method of saline water electrolysis that can both capture CO2 from the atmosphere and use that carbon to neutralize ocean acidification.
